  1. Lyman Frank Baum (* 15. Mai 1856 in Chittenango, New York; † 6. Mai 1919 in Los Angeles) war ein US-amerikanischer Schriftsteller. Er schrieb den Kinderbuch-Klassiker Der Zauberer von Oz ( The Wonderful Wizard of Oz) sowie 13 Fortsetzungsromane, die in der von ihm erdachten Zauberwelt Oz spielen.

  2. Lyman Frank Baum (/ b ɔː m /; May 15, 1856 – May 6, 1919) was an American author best known for his children's fantasy books, particularly The Wonderful Wizard of Oz, part of a series. In addition to the 14 Oz books, Baum penned 41 other novels (not including four lost, unpublished novels), 83 short stories, over 200 poems, and ...

  3. The Wonderful Wizard of Oz is a 1900 children's novel written by author L. Frank Baum and illustrated by W. W. Denslow. It is the first novel in the Oz series of books . A Kansas farm girl named Dorothy ends up in the magical Land of Oz after she and her pet dog Toto are swept away from their home by a cyclone . [2]

Frank Baum (born May 15, 1856, Chittenango, New York, U.S.—died May 6, 1919, Hollywood, California) was an American writer known for his series of books for children about the imaginary land of Oz. Baum began his career as a journalist, initially in Aberdeen, South Dakota, and then in Chicago.
